Saltoftehus, with tranquillity, timbered houses and a modern conference centre, lies in the countryside in West Zealand.

The building sits on 400 hectares of picturesque, agricultural land near Kalundborg. It is approximately one hour’s drive from Copenhagen. Accommodation is in historic buildings, namely, The Horse Stable, The Student Wing and The Fruit Storage. The building's exterior reveals its age, while the modern interior has the latest technology and is in accord with Green Key standards. The amenities which include comfort, flexibility and high-speed internet with worldwide connection, meet the demands of our international clientele.

Enjoy the estate’s private forest and the surrounding countryside which offers fresh air, open skies and beautiful birdsong.

Environmental efforts

Green Key member since 2010.

Saltoftehus and Saltofte Estate are heated by a modern CO2-neutral Faust straw boiler. The entire property, powered by solar cells, is self-sufficient and CO2 neutral. The drinking water is also CO2-neutral, and three newly renovated buildings use low-energy bulbs.

Area

Central and West Zealand

In Central Zealand you will find Roskilde with the Cathedral and the Viking Ship Museum and in the area National Park Skjoldungernes Land and Roskilde and Holbæk Fjord.

The western part of Zealand offers small cozy towns such as Kalundborg, Korsør, Sorø and Skælskør and quiet harbors and beautiful fjords, and nature invites you to explore it by bike, by hiking or kayaking.
